Biomass per animal = 85 g (wet weight)
dry weight/wet weight ratio (dw/ww) = 0.35
gramms of carbon/gramms of dry weight = 0.45

Basal metabolism = 0.040976 Kcal/gww per day
Free living metabolism = basal metabolism x 2
Free living metabolism = Respiration = 0.08195 Kcal/gww*day
Mean food caloric content = 4.5 Kcal/g of dry weight
Mean food Carbon content = 45% of dry weight

P/B Production/Biomass ratio (P/B) = 2.6 yearly rate
Banse, K. and S. Mosher, 1980.
Excretion/Consumption ratio (E/C) = 0.35

Mice and Rats feed on: Understory, Hardwood Leaves, Terrestrial
Invertebrates, Omnivorous Passerines, and Predatory Passerines.
